*{
	margin:0;
	padding: 0;
	outline: 0;
	z-index: 0;
}

html,
body {
	margin:0;
	padding:0;
	width:100%;
	height:100%;
}

#top{
	height:50% !important;
	background:#292929;
	min-height:240px;
	min-width:510px;
	position:relative;
}

#logo{
	position:relative;
	margin:0 auto;
}
#logoimg{
	padding:20px;
	margin:0 auto;
	width:439px;
	height:194px;
}

#reserveerd{
	width:100%;
	min-width:510px;
	height:45px;
	padding:8px 0;
}

.oranje{
	background:#f9ab47;
}

.paars{
	background:#8b97cc;
}

.geel{
	background:#fed18b;
}

#broodtekst{
	width:510px;
	height:35%;
	margin: 0 auto !important;
}

.broodtekst {
	float:left;
	padding:20px;
	width:215px;
	height:100%;
}

img{
	border:none;
}

#tagcloud{
	width:215px;
	margin:auto;
}

@media screen and (max-width: 480px){
	#top{
		height:50% !important;
		background:#292929;
		min-height:150px;
		min-width:320px;
		position:relative;
	}
	
	#logoimg{
		padding:20px;
		margin:0 auto;
		width:250px;
		height:110px;
	}
	
	#reserveerd{
	min-width:320px;
	height:30px;
	padding:8px 0;
	}
	
	h1{
		font-size:24px;
	}

	#broodtekst, .broodtekst{
		width:320px;
		margin: 0 auto !important;
	}
	
	.broodtekst{
		padding:15px 0;
	}
	
	.v3{
		display:none;
	}
}